Flat Roof Inspection in Gettysburg, PA
Flat ro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of the roofing system to identify potential issues or areas of concern. These inspections typically cover various types of flat roofs, including commercial, residential, and industrial projects. Property owners often seek these inspections before purchasing a property, after severe weather events, or as part of routine maintenance to ensure the roof remains in good condition. The process usually includes checking for sign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, ponding water, or membrane deterioration, and evaluating the overall integrity of the roofing materials.
Homeowners and property owners should consider what specific concerns they have about their flat roof before requesting an inspection. Common questions include whether there are leaks, if the roof shows signs of aging, or if repairs might be necessary. Understanding the scope of the inspection, including what areas will be examined and what issues might be identified, helps property owners make informed decisions about maintenance or repairs. An inspection provides valuable insights into the roof’s condition, helping to prevent costly damage and extend the lifespan of the roofing system.

Flat Roof Inspection Questions
What is included in a flat roof inspection? An inspection typically assesses the roof’s surface for damage, checks for ponding water, and examines flashing and seams for vulnerabilities.
How often should a flat roof be inspected? Flat roofs should be in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to identify potential issues early.
What signs indicate a flat roof needs repairs? Signs include water stains on ceilings, pooling water, cracks, blistering, or visible damage to the roofing material.
Why is regular flat roof inspection important? Regular inspections help prevent costly repairs by catching minor issues before they develop into major problems.
